OUR LARGEST PILING PROJECT COMPLETED IN THE LAST 10 YEARS

Project Description

SCOPE OF WORKS 14,558 Precast Piles

CONTRACTOR Bowmer and Kirkland

EQUIPMENT 8 x Junttan PM20/22, 14,558 Precast Piles

CONSTRUCTION PERIOD 14 weeks

Aarsleff were working for Bowmer and Kirkland constructing a large scale piling job for commercial sheds in the North-East of England. This is the largest piling job Aarsleff have completed in the last 10 years. This job consisted of just under 15,000 precast piles and 8 Junttan PM20/22 Rigs. The precast reinforced concrete piles used by Aarsleff are manufactured by sister company Centrum Pile Ltd at their state-of-the-art facility at Newark, Nottinghamshire.

Casting is a fully automatic process using bespoke
machines designed by Centrum specifically for pile
production with selfcompacting concrete which does
not require vibration.

Technical Information
• 12,766no. 250mm T4 precast reinforced concrete piles
• 1,436no. 250mm T6 precast reinforced concrete piles
• 356no. 300mm T8 precast reinforced concrete piles
